What is human resource executive search?

Executive search is a specialized form of recruitment function that involves the ‘hunt’ for highly qualified /top-talent candidates for senior and executive job positions within a given organization. Previously, executive search was informally known as ‘headhunting.’

Human resource executive search firms are third party firms that perform the above function on behalf of organizations. HR executive search is not only limited to the senior executives such as CEO's and CFO's. The search also includes looking for highly specialized/ top talent individuals for which there is a strong demand in the market. This includes positions such as lead data analysts and computer programmers.

Besides, many firms today opt to have interim managers or interim executives as opposed to traditional managers. The process is still the same as leadership assessment is at the core of the evaluation process.

Step 1: The Initial Meeting

The entire process starts with the initial contact/meeting involving both the client and the recruitment firm (s). The meetings progressively advance as both firms share more details such as the requirements, timeline, and analysis of the company, just to mention a few.

Step 2: Creating a Job Description

After meeting with the client, the search firm then creates a job description based on the research performed by the search firm and requirements, as discussed by the client’s firm.

Job descriptions often contain detailed information about the career and educational responsibilities, qualifications roles, resume CV presentation guidelines and expectations of the executive job position.

Step 3: Finalizing the Search Plan

After creating a job description, the search firm will research further to determine which candidate is best suited for the position. Here negotiations involving details like retainer fee could be arranged.

Top HR executive search firms such as Flexi Personnel have advanced strategies and their complex network of databases to shortlist the best executive candidates for the given assignment.

Step 4: Interviews with the Candidate

The next step after the search for shortlisted candidates would be to have face to face interviews. Recently, the COVID-19 pandemic has restricted many face-to-face meetings, and recruiters have been forced to settle for online meetings through platforms such as Zoom and Google Meet.

After a series of interviews, the client will then select a candidate. Shortly afterwards, the process of salary negotiations and other agreements are formalized. The last step would be to announce the appointment of the candidate
